Add. Cloud Terms
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| Amazon Elastic Container Service for Kubernetes (EKS) | a managed Kubernetes service that makes it easy to run Kubernetes on AWS w/o needing to install, operate, and maintain own control plane |
| Amazon Neptune | a fast, reliable, fully managed graph database service that makes it easy to build and run applications that work with highly connected datasets. |
| AWS Migration Hub | provides a single location to track the progress of application migrations across multiple AWS and partner solutions. |
| AWS Database Migration Service | helps you migrate databases to AWS quickly and securely. |
| AWS Server Migration Service | an agentless service which makes it easier and faster for you to migrate thousands of on-premises workloads to AWS |
| Amazon API Gateway | a fully managed service that makes it easy for developers to create, publish, maintain, monitor, and secure APIs at any scale. |
| AWS CodeStar | enables you to quickly develop, build, and deploy applications on AWS + provides a unified user interface, enabling easily manage software development activities in one place. |
| AWS CodeCommit | fully managed source control service that hosts secure Git-based repositories. |
| AWS CodeBuild | a fully managed continuous integration service that compiles source code, runs tests, and produces software packages that are ready to deploy. |
| AWS CodeDeploy | a fully managed deployment service that automates software deployments to a variety of compute services such as Amazon EC2, AWS Lambda, and your on-premises servers. |
| AWS CodePipeline | a fully managed continuous delivery service that helps you automate your release pipelines for fast and reliable application and infrastructure updates. |
| AWS X-Ray | helps developers analyze and debug production, distributed applications, such as those built using a microservices architecture. |
| AWS Managed Services | provides ongoing management of your AWS infrastructure so you can focus on your applications. |
| Amazon Athena | an interactive query service that makes it easy to analyze data in Amazon S3 using standard SQL. |
| Amazon EMR | provides a managed Hadoop framework that makes it easy, fast, and cost-effective to process vast amounts of data across dynamically scalable Amazon EC2 instances. |
| Amazon CloudSearch | a managed service in the AWS Cloud that makes it simple and cost-effective to set up, manage, and scale a search solution for your website or application. |
| Amazon Elasticsearch | a fully managed service that makes it easy for you to deploy, secure, operate, and scale Elasticsearch to search, analyze, and visualize data in real-time. |
| Amazon Kinesis | makes it easy to collect, process, and analyze real-time, streaming data so you can get timely insights and react quickly to new information. |
| AWS Data Pipeline | a web service that helps you reliably process and move data between different AWS compute and storage services, as well as on-premises data sources, at specified intervals. |
| AWS Glue | a fully managed extract, transform, and load (ETL) service that makes it easy for customers to prepare and load their data for analytics. |
| Amazon Elastic Transcoder | media transcoding in the cloud. |
| AWS AppSync | easy to build data-driven mobile + browser apps that deliver responsive, collaborative experiences by keeping the data updated when devices are connected, enable the app to use local data when offline, + synchronizing the data when the devices reconnect. |
| AWS Device Farm | an app testing service that lets you test and interact with your Android, iOS, and web apps on many devices at once, or reproduce issues on a device in real time. |
| Amazon Workspaces | a managed, secure cloud desktop service |
| AWS AppStream | Fully managed non-persistent application streaming service. |
| AWS WorkLink | Provides secure, one-click access to your internal websites and web apps using mobile phone browsers. |
| AWS WorkDocs | Fully managed, secure content creation, storage, and collaboration service |
| AWS IoT Core | Describes the network of physical objects that are embedded with sensors or software. |
| Amazon Simple Storage Service (S3) | object storage built to store and retrieve any amount of data from anywhere – web sites and mobile apps, corporate applications, and data from IoT sensors or devices. |
| S3 Standard | durable, immediately available, frequently accessed |
| S3 Intelligent-Tiering | automatically moves data to the most cost-effective tier |
| S3 Standard-IA | durable, immediately available, infrequently accessed |
| S3 One Zone-IA | lower cost for infrequently accessed data with less resilience |
| S3 Glacier Instant Retrieval | data that is rarely accessed and requires retrieval in milliseconds |
| S3 Glacier Flexible Retrieval | archived data, retrieval times in minutes or hours |
| S3 Glacier Deep Archive | (lowest cost storage class for long term retention). |
| AWS Snowball | transfer hundreds of terabytes or petabytes of data between your on-premises data centers and Amazon S3 |
| AWS Snowball Client | software that is installed on a local computer and is used to identify, compress, encrypt, and transfer data |
| Amazon Elastic Block Store (EBS) | provides persistent block storage volumes for use w/ EC2 instances in cloud |
| EBS Snapshots | capture a point-in-time state of an instance. |
| Instance Store Volumes | high performance local disks that are physically attached to host computer on which an EC2 instance runs |
| Amazon Elastic File System (EFS) | fully managed service that makes it easy to set up and scale file storage in the Cloud |
| AWS Storage Gateway | a hybrid cloud storage service that gives you on-premises access to virtually unlimited cloud storage |
| File Gateway | provides file system interfaces to on-premises servers. |
| Volume Gateway | provides block-based access for on-premises servers. |
| Tape Gateway | provides a virtual tape library that is compatible with common backup software (block and file interfaces). |
| AWS Backup | offers a centralized backup console, APIs, and command line interface for managing backups across AWS services |
| Amazon FSX for Lustre | provides scalable, high-performance, cost-effective storage for compute workloads + shared storage with sub-ms latencies, up to terabytes of throughput, and millions of IOPS |
| Amazon FSX for Windows File Server | Your applications and end users can access reliable, performant, and secure shared file storage |
